The FP3 sensor has high mechanical stability and a well-protected sensor surface. This renders it useful for high air velocity applications, as well as for air contaminated with solid particles. It has an excellent response to varying humidity conditions, and the fastest resetting rate of all sensors tested. The speed with which FP3 responds to varying humidity conditions and temperature limits are equivalent to European products. Dew point stability is outstanding, the best of all tested sensors. Long-term accuracy is good, although some drifting is noted, which may be corrected by recalibration. Solvent vapour resistance is excellent with Isopropanol and Glycerin. Resistance against 100ppm chlorine in air is limited due to corrosion of legs. There is just one competitive sensor with good chlorine resistance; all other sensors tested fail.
